Vulnerable marine ecosystems (VMEs): Coral and sponge VMEs in Arctic and sub-Arctic waters – Distribution and threats

This report presents results from the NovasArc project that has collated data on the distribution of vulnerable marine ecosystems (VMEs) in Arctic and sub-Arctic waters. Eleven VMEs were identified, based on management goals for coral and sponge communities. Many of the vulnerable marine ecosystems (VMEs) in the study area has a wide distribution. Soft and hard bottom sponge aggregations, hard bottom gorgonians, sublittoral sea pen communities, and cauliflower corals are predicted to cover > 20% of the study area shallower than 1000 meters. Winged Worlds

This edited collection explores our often-surprising modes of co-inhabiting the cultural and aerial worlds of birds. It focuses on our encounters with non-captive birds and the cultural geographies of feathered flight. This book offers a timely contribution to the more-than-human geographies of flight, space and territory. The chapters support an ethics of attention as a new basis for the conservation and cultivation of aerial habitats. Contributions adopt an interdisciplinary approach to the patterns of intrusion and escape that shape our encounters with birds and unsettle our traditionally terrestrial concepts of space. Each chapter focuses on a different aspect of our shared lives with birds, ranging from scientific observation to the social media-enabled spectacle of co-habitation and spatial competition. Written in a thought-provoking style, this book seeks to address a dearth of critical perspectives on the cultural geographies of flight and its implications for the ways in which we understand common spaces around and above us in the context of any effort at conservation.

Mapping Species Distributions

Maps of species' distributions or habitat suitability are required for many aspects of environmental research, resource management and conservation planning. These include biodiversity assessment, reserve design, habitat management and restoration, species and habitat conservation plans and predicting the effects of environmental change on species and ecosystems. The proliferation of methods and uncertainty regarding their effectiveness can be daunting to researchers, resource managers and conservation planners alike. Franklin summarises the methods used in species distribution modeling (also called niche modeling) and presents a framework for spatial prediction of species distributions based on the attributes (space, time, scale) of the data and questions being asked. The framework links theoretical ecological models of species distributions to spatial data on species and environment, and statistical models used for spatial prediction. Providing practical guidelines to students, researchers and practitioners in a broad range of environmental sciences including ecology, geography, conservation biology, and natural resources management.
